Abstract:
The independent study is to design and fabricate welding defects in specimens. The purposes of thisthesis are applying to use for training and certifying inspectors according to ASNT-TC-1A anddecreasing the number of import specimens. In the research, the material type is AISI 1025,fabricated by welding on groove weld in flat position and had been tested by non-destructive testingfollow ASME code section. To test and approve the position, the number, size and types of defects,the welding defects in the specimens are divided into two types. They are surface and weldmetaldefect. The surface defect in the specimen is surface crack which is varied by the amount of copperalloy in weldmetal. The results show that cracks are found in multidirection and not found by visualtesting. The position, size and the number of defects can not be controlled. In case of defects in theweldmetal, types of defect are longitudinal crack, lack of penetration, lack of side wall, slag andporosity. The result obtained from the radiographic testing found all three types of defect.Additionally, the position, size and quanltitative of defects can be controlled in the target.
